Output 3e0a569bc4f3f859965c69b8a9bc9ffb40a2239c21c109718eed9f4a33bafb84:17

value
108135
script pubkey
OP_0 OP_PUSHBYTES_32 1faca58ec19ccb28b9a62d0343a427fb57dfd7e986ea9e75261a997bb4d67718
address
bc1qr7k2trkpnn9j3wdx95p58fp8ldtal4lfsm4fuafxr2vhhdxkwuvqw5qqud
transaction
3e0a569bc4f3f859965c69b8a9bc9ffb40a2239c21c109718eed9f4a33bafb84
confirmations
105767
spent
true